Adam Geibel (1855–1933)

Lyrics

The cares of the day oft per­plex us,
The pathway we tread oft seems bare;
The sun seems to shine but for oth­ers,
There seems to be no one to care;
But someone is watching our foot­steps,
He’s guiding us o’er the dark way;
His love, like the glo­ri­ous sun­shine,
Will drive all the shadows away.

That life which the sun ne­ver brighten­ed,
With misery and pain ev­ery­where,
May reach out in faith and may find Him
Who waits every sor­row to share.
He holds out His hands pierced and wound­ed,
He knows of the bur­den each day;
He’ll take all the thorns from our path­way,
And drive all the sha­dows away.

There’s no one can help us like Je­sus,
No bur­den’s too hea­vy for Him;
He wants every life filled with sun­shine;
With light that shall ne­ver grow dim.
And daily He’s watch­ing our foot­steps,
And leading us all the lone way;
We’ll trust in His dear lov­ing kind­ness,
To drive all the sha­dows away.
